Delivery Performance definition

Delivery Performance. Lacks shall deliver Cladded Wheels to Ford in accordance with (i) the delivery times specified in Accuride's QS-9000 procedure 4.6 as set forth on Schedule 3 attached hereto, and (ii) any delivery notices or release orders Accuride may provide to Lacks in agreement with Lacks' process timing requirements which shall at no time exceed four (4) weeks. Lacks requests copies of Ford' 830 and 862 releases.

Examples of Delivery Performance in a sentence

  • In the event Distributor: (i) knowingly and intentionally sells any Inventory marked with Jamba Juice’s, name and/or trademarks to third parties without JJC’s prior written consent and/or (ii) fails to meet either the Delivery Performance Standards or Service Levels for two (2) consecutive quarters, it is agreed this is an incurable Default and at JJC’s election the thirty (30) day period to remedy is not required.

  • Service Delivery Performance: These would be based on standard order lead times, service installation and completion dates, testing and documentation provided at service turn-up, formal acceptance testing and verification of service quality, and delivery integrity against order specifications.

  • Failure to meet the Delivery Performance Standards will be evidenced by a copy of the invoice relating to the delayed delivery, with a brief explanation of why delivery was late, signed, time noted, and dated by the Store Manager.

  • Failure by Distributor to meet the Service Level and/or the Delivery Performance Standard for two (2) consecutive quarters shall constitute an incurable Default and will result in (i) JJC’s right to cancel this Agreement without penalty to JJC pursuant to Section 24 and 25 hereof, and (ii) at JJC’s option, transfer of the Inventory to JJC’s designated agent at Distributor’s Landed Cost without ▇▇▇▇-up following thirty (30) days’ notice to Distributor.

  • Distributor and JJC shall review Distributor’s actual performance against the Service Level and the Delivery Performance Standard on a quarterly basis.

  • Damaged or Short Supplied Delivery related complaints are documented by our Customer Service Department using a Delivery Performance Report, which is forwarded to our Logistics Department and our Transport Provider for investigation and resolution.

  • The Delivery Performance criterion measures Supplier’s ability to deliver the right quantity of Contract Products on the date specified in the Delivery Schedule.

  • The Delivery Performance measures Supplier’s compliance to keep the Contract Products stock within the agreed minimum and maximum inventory limits.

  • Distributor shall maintain a Delivery Performance Standard of 98.5% for On-time deliveries; 98.5% for Deliveries without Complaint; 80% Perfect Order Rate; +/- 0.5% aggregate Inventory Accuracy per item.

  • The JVC will maintain On-Time Delivery Performance equal to or greater than *** percent (***%), as measured each fiscal quarter.
